Subtask 34-52-00-740-054-C ** ON A/C NOT FOR ALL
A. BITE Test of the ATC

ACTION
RESULT
On the MCDU:
On the MCDU:
1.On the NAV page, push the line key adjacent to the ATC1 (ATC2) indication.
  • The ATC1 (ATC2) page comes into view.
2.Push the line key adjacent to the TEST indication.
  • The ATC1 (ATC2) TEST page with the INITIAL CONDITIONS indication comes into view.
3.Push the line key adjacent to the START TEST indication.
On the ATC/TCAS control unit:

  • The ATC FAULT or FAIL indicator light comes on for approximately two seconds.
    On the MCDU:

  • The ATC1 (ATC2) TEST page with the TEST IN PROGRESS indication comes into view.
  • After few seconds, the TEST OK indication comes into view.
4.Push the line key adjacent to the RETURN indication.
  • The ATC1 (ATC2) TEST CLOSE-UP page comes into view.
5.Push the line key adjacent to the RETURN indication.
  • The test procedure stops.

Subtask 34-52-00-740-054-H ** ON A/C NOT FOR ALL
A. BITE Test of the ATC
ACTION
RESULT
1. FOR [1SH1]
On aft electronics rack 80VU, on the transponder front panel, push and release the "PUSH TO TEST" button.
  • All the transponder front panel lamps come on for approximately three seconds.

  • At the end of the test, the XPDR P/F lamp comes on green for approximately 10 seconds and then goes off.
